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Marmot | Iceland Gull |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Charadriiformes (Charadriiformes) |
| Family | Sciuridae (Squirrels) | Laridae |
| Genus | Marmota | Larus |
| Species | Marmota baibacina | Larus glaucoides |
Evolutionary Relationship
Gray Marmot and Iceland Gull share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
